There's an evolving innovation in the manufacturing process of hot dip galvanized wire as well. Producers are now optimizing zinc application techniques to enhance adhesion and coating uniformity further, which in turn enhances the wire's protective qualities. Such advancements prove the industry’s dedication to delivering ever more reliable wire solutions that meet increasing demands for sustainability and efficiency. In evaluating suppliers of hot dip galvanized wire, expert advice champions the importance of considering the consistency and purity of the zinc coating along with the wire's tensile strength specifications. These factors are critical in ensuring that the wire performs to its fullest potential and meets the rigorous demands of diverse applications.
